Sparks Nevada Complaint — Breach of Life Insurance Coverage Policy When it comes to life insurance coverage policies, it is essential to understand the terms, conditions, and benefits provided by the insurance company. However, sometimes policyholders in Sparks Nevada may find themselves in situations where their life insurance coverage policy is breached, leading to dissatisfaction and potential legal action. In such instances, filing a Sparks Nevada Complaint — Breach of Life Insurance Coverage Policy can be the appropriate course of action. Life insurance coverage policies can vary in terms of their specifics, and the breach can occur in different ways. Understanding the different types of breaches is crucial for policyholders in Sparks Nevada who believe their rights have been violated. 1. Premium non-payment breach: This type of breach occurs when the policyholder fails to pay the premium within the stipulated grace period, leading to the policy becoming void or lapse. The insurance company should provide clear guidelines on premium payments and grace periods to avoid any misunderstandings. 2. Denial of claim breach: If an insurance company refuses to honor a legitimate claim made by the policyholder, it can be considered a breach of the life insurance coverage policy. Common reasons for claim denials include incomplete paperwork, inaccurate information, or disputed interpretation of policy terms. 3. Misrepresentation breach: A policyholder who provides inaccurate or misleading information during the application process might face a breach of the life insurance coverage policy. This can result in the insurance company denying future claims or canceling the policy, citing material misrepresentation. 4. Breach of policy terms breach: Any failure on the part of the insurance company to adhere to the terms and conditions specified in the life insurance coverage policy may constitute a breach. Examples may include delays in claim processing, failure to provide policy updates or notifications, or unexplained changes to policy features without proper consent. Regardless of the type of breach, policyholders in Sparks Nevada have the right to express their dissatisfaction and seek resolution. To address a Sparks Nevada Complaint — Breach of Life Insurance Coverage Policy, individuals should follow specific steps: 1. Review the policy: Thoroughly examine the policy document to understand the coverage terms, exclusions, and conditions. This will help identify any potential breaches by the insurance company. 2. Document incidents: Maintain a detailed record of all interactions, including dates, times, names of company representatives, and summaries of discussions. This documentation will serve as valuable evidence in case legal action becomes necessary. 3. Contact the insurance company: Initiate contact with the insurance company's customer service department or file a formal complaint with their designated complaint handling unit. Clearly explain the nature of the breach and provide supporting documentation to substantiate your claim. 4. Seek legal counsel: If the insurance company fails to address the complaint satisfactorily, it may be advisable to consult with an attorney specializing in insurance law. They can provide guidance on available legal remedies, such as filing a lawsuit, mediation, or arbitration. Handling a Sparks Nevada Complaint — Breach of Life Insurance Coverage Policy can be complex, requiring expertise in insurance regulations and legal proceedings. Seeking professional assistance is often beneficial in ensuring fair treatment and potential financial compensation if the breach has caused harm or financial losses to the policyholder.
